Output 5beb62320e6c0629593da3d74c48fdee50becaab4e45f2b3b062d620a1dda763:0

value
655557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869b5e3a4b8408b0b961c0812ce0cc411999a370 OP_EQUAL
address
3DxkbQs91DgSCTaRkJF5zuKDQuAD5m5Knd
transaction
5beb62320e6c0629593da3d74c48fdee50becaab4e45f2b3b062d620a1dda763
confirmations
185333
spent
true